Imageon™ 2240
 

Features

Advanced 2D Graphics
  • BitBLT, ROP3 and ROP4
  • DrawLine, Sprites
  • Font caching, font antialiasing
  • Scaling
  • Alpha blending
  • 90, 180, and 270 degree rotation
  • Gouraud shading
  • Scissoring
  • Transparent BLT
Video Capture
  • Connect video peripherals (such as a camera or TV tuner) to the handheld
  • device
  • Supports high resolution camera sensors
  • CCIR 656, YCrCb 4:2:2 with 8-bit data bus
  • Preview input image – downscale by 1/2/3/5/6/8/10/12
  • Zoom Video Support – separate VSYNC, HSYNC
  • Interlaced Image Support
  • Image cropping through programmable capture rectangle
MPEG / JPEG Decode Acceleration
  • iDCT engine
  • Motion Compensation
  • Scaling
  • Colour Space Conversion (CSC) for overlay / preview
  • MPEG-4 QCIF hardware-assisted decode at 30-fps
JPEG Encoder
  • DCT
  • Quantization and variable length encode
  • Produces CCITT T.81 compliant baseline sequential JPEG scan
  • Single shot encoder of incoming video
Integrated Frame Buffer
  • Double-buffer support for QCIF+ resolution
Host Interface
Imageon™ 2240 interfaces seamlessly to the following CPUs:
  • Intel® XScale
  • Motorola MX
  • TI OMAP
  • Other ARM-based System-on-Chips
  • A number of proprietary CPUs and baseband chipsets
Bus Configurations Supported
  • Indirect Addressing Modes:
    • 1-bit address bus and 16-bit data bus
    • 1-bit address bus and 8-bit data bus
    • 1-bit address bus and 1-bit data bus
Display Support
  • Primary:
    • 8 bit monochrome, 12/15/16/18 bit colour STN
    • 12/15/16/18 bit TFT
    • 5-wire serial and 8/16-bit parallel (CPUlike)
    • smart-display interfaces
    • Maximum resolution QCIF+
    • Partial display refresh
    • Frame modulation
    • Panel rotation (90, 180, 270)
    • Single overlay, single colour key
    • Alpha blending (with global Alpha) and colour keying of overlays + graphics
  • Secondary:
    • 5-wire serial and 8/16-bit parallel (CPU-like) smart-display interfaces
    • Supports 128Kbytes Command/ Data lengths
    • support for 8-bit monochrome as well as color displays (RGB color formats 332, 444, 565, 666)
  • Passthrough, Transparent, or By-Pass Mode:
    • Allows direct host control of serial /parallel display when Imageon™ device in power-down or in sleep modes
Clock Source
  • 32 kHz
Operating Voltage
  • 1.5V to 3.3V CPU, LCD, VIP, and GPIO Interfaces
  • 1.2V to 1.8V Core Supply.
Power Saving Features
  • Dynamic power down for Inactive blocks
  • Low power / low voltage process
  • Power consumption
    • Suspend < 40uW nominal
    • Display refresh < 1mW nominal
    • Average active mode 10mW
Development Support
  • Reference Design Kit
  • Diagnostic utility
  • Demonstration software
API Interface
  • AMD Handheld Interface (AHI) device driver
Supported Operating Systems
  • Microsoft Windows Mobile and SmartPhone
  • Windows CE 5.0
  • Symbian
  • Java
  • Nucleus
  • Other proprietary OS
